Celebrity Cruises is offering a Caribbean Culinary Cruise with Iris McCallister, the co-founder of Dallas’ premier food and wine festival Chefs for Farmers. You’ll essentially be eating your way through the Caribbean — with the help of an expert guide. Ports of call include San Juan, Puerto Rico; Charlotte Amalie, St. Thomas; and Philipsburg, St. Maarten.

This special cruise sails April 8 through 15, 2018, still giving you plenty of time to plan.

And salivate over the foodie thrills to come. Almost every cruise touts its food. The difference is this is a cruise where eating well (and local in the ports of call) is the main itinerary. 

Cruisers will enjoy a stroll through Old San Juan, tasting their way through historical neighborhoods. The St. Thomas stop is centered around a progressive three-course meal at a local fruit farm, restaurant and bar (they’ll also be time to enjoy historic Charlotte Amalie).

But the main event is Chef Market Discoveries — winner of the 2016 Travel Weekly Shore Excursions Silver Magellan Award — with “The Flavors of Marigot.” You’ll join McCallister and the executive chef of the ship in St. Maarten for a visit to a local Dutch cheese shop and sample various cheeses paired with wine. Then it’s time for a scenic drive over Cay Hill to St. Maarten’s French capital, Marigot.

You’ll enjoy shore excursions that expose you to the best local markets.

Browse fresh spices, herbs, and produce; enjoy a special tasting after a unique demonstration; and learn to source local vegetables and fish. The journey ends at Grand Case, the French gourmet capital of the Caribbean, where you’ll visit a renowned local restaurant with a breathtaking view of the bay.

It’s a foodie’s dream day — and it doesn’t even end when everyone gets back on the boat at the end of the day. A dinner featuring the treasures found in St. Maarten will be prepared on the ship for everyone to enjoy.
